Define the Exact Application Requirement
Before evaluating suppliers or pricing, we establish clear operational intent. Every shot blasting machine must be selected based on use-case precision, not general specifications.
Key parameters to lock in:
- Type of components (castings, forgings, sheets, structures)
- Component dimensions and weight
- Daily and hourly production volume
- Required surface finish (SA 2, SA 2.5, SA 3)
- Rust, scale, paint, or contamination level
Machines selected without this clarity often underperform or overconsume resources.

Select the Correct Shot Blasting Machine Type
Matching application to machine type is non-negotiable. We evaluate suitability across standard industrial configurations:
- Portable Shot Blasting Machine – On-site surface preparation, pipelines, tanks
- Cabinet Type Shot Blasting Machine – Precision parts, workshops, job work
- Hanger Type Shot Blasting Machine – Heavy components, uniform all-round blasting
- Tumble Type Shot Blasting Machine – Bulk small components
- Roller Conveyor Shot Blasting Machine – Plates, beams, structural sections
- Table Type Shot Blasting Machine – Flat or circular components
- Automatic Shot Blasting Machine – High-volume, repeat production lines
Selecting the wrong type increases cycle time and abrasive consumption.

Inspect Blast Wheel Technology
The blast wheel defines blasting quality and operating cost. We prioritize machines with:
- High-efficiency turbines
- Optimized blade geometry
- Dynamic wheel balancing
- Easy-access maintenance design
Critical evaluation factors:
- kW rating vs actual throw efficiency
- Uniform abrasive distribution
- Wear plate material and life expectancy
Inferior blast wheels increase abrasive usage and electricity costs.
Assess Abrasive Recovery and Separation System
Efficient abrasive recovery is essential for cost control. We examine:
- Screw conveyors and bucket elevators
- Air wash separators
- Dust-free abrasive circulation
Checklist requirements:
- Effective separation of dust, fines, and reusable abrasive
- Minimal abrasive loss per shift
- Smooth, jam-free material flow
A weak recovery system directly increases consumable expenses.
Verify Dust Collection and Filtration Efficiency
Compliance and operator safety depend on dust control. Industrial buyers must insist on:
- High-capacity dust collectors
- Cartridge or bag filter systems
- Pulse-jet cleaning mechanisms
Mandatory checks:
- Airflow capacity (CFM)
- Filtration efficiency rating
- Emission control compliance
Poor dust extraction compromises workplace safety and machine lifespan.

Confirm Structural Build and Wear Protection
Machine longevity depends on construction quality. We inspect:
- Cabinet thickness and fabrication quality
- Use of manganese steel or rubber liners
- Reinforced blast zones
Structural checklist:
- Anti-vibration design
- Wear-resistant internal linings
- Corrosion-protected external surfaces
Thin enclosures and poor lining result in early breakdowns.
